PMDG_737NGX_2.dll APPCRASH when closing FSX

Featured Replies

Hopefully someone has some advice for me,

I recently upgraded my NGX to the latest version using Roberts' advice of a clean install. My issue is now when I close FSX I get an APPCRASH message with the fault module name PMDG_737NGX_2.dll.

This did not happen prior to upgrade.

Just an update,

PMDG_777X_2.dll gives the same error as the PMDG_737NGX_2.dll when exiting FSX. These appear to be Flexnet security activation modules that give an error.

The previous versions did not give an error.

Andrew,

We have a few reports from some users about this.

We are evaluating, but it is a very low priority right now because it isn't affecting anyone while simming.  We have a few higher priority items that are affecting people WHILE simming- so we want to knock those down first.

Once we find what is causing this, we will kill it too...
